STATE v. BENOIT

No. 90-KA-346.

570 So.2d 490 (1990)

STATE of Louisiana v. Dean E. BENOIT.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, Fifth Circuit.

November 14, 1990.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John Crum, Dist. Atty., Thomas Daley, Asst. Dist. Atty., Rodney A. Brignac, Asst. Dist. Atty., Edgard, for plaintiff-appellee.

Richard E. Holley, Springfield, for defendant-appellant.

Before KLIEBERT, BOWES and GOTHARD, JJ.


KLIEBERT, Judge.

Defendant, Dean Benoit, was charged with vehicular homicide, a violation of LSA-R.S. 14:32.1,1 following an automobile accident on Interstate 55 which resulted in two deaths. Defendant moved to suppress the results of a blood test administered following the accident and of statements made to State Trooper Van Penouilh.
